Skillet Sauerbraten

Bite-sized pieces of beef, coated in crushed ginger snaps, are browned then simmered in onion soup and cider vinegar for an easy version of the favorite German dish.

what you need

16
 NABISCO Ginger Snaps
2
lb. beef shoulder steak, cut into bite-sized pieces
1/4
cup oil
1
can (10-1/2 oz.) condensed onion soup
2/3
cup water
1/2
cup cider vinegar

Make It

CRUSH ginger snaps in resealable plastic bag with rolling pin. Add meat; close bag and shake gently until meat is evenly coated.

HEAT oil in large skillet on medium-high heat. Add meat; cook until lightly browned, stirring occasionally. Add soup, water and vinegar; mix well. Bring to boil. Reduce heat to low; cover.

SIMMER 30 to 35 min. or until meat is tender, stirring occasionally. Stir in remaining crumbs from bag; simmer 1 min.

Round Out The Meal
Serve with mashed potatoes or noodles.
